Buffalo childcare centers, from Elmwood Village to Amherst to the growing Northtowns suburbs, deal with a wave of winter closures and delayed openings that scramble parent schedules and inquiry timing. When a snow day shuts down a center for the day, calls and texts often pile up all at once, and staff already stretched thin covering ratio simply cannot keep up. A parent searching for an open toddler spot after a canceled commute expects a quick answer, and if nobody responds, they call the next center on Google.

What Pulse does

AI workflows built for childcare in Buffalo

Weather-Resilient Call Answering

Calls and texts get answered even during closures or call surges, capturing key details so nothing gets lost when your front desk is overwhelmed.

Waitlist Auto-Fill

When a spot opens, your waitlist is texted automatically in order, filling seats quickly instead of waiting for staff to catch up after a busy stretch.

Tour Reminders

Automated reminders the day before and morning of an appointment reduce no-shows tied to Buffalo's unpredictable winter weather.

Closure Notifications and Re-Engagement

When you close for weather, the system can notify inquiring families and follow up automatically once you reopen.

Daily Pipeline Report

A daily summary of calls, tours, and enrollments helps your director stay on top of the pipeline even during a chaotic week.
